Transaction e5177a5653c7246700cc8563f0c5497233ba717e4dbf19f819a0817c6aeff7e3
1 Input
2 Outputs
- e5177a5653c7246700cc8563f0c5497233ba717e4dbf19f819a0817c6aeff7e3:0
- e5177a5653c7246700cc8563f0c5497233ba717e4dbf19f819a0817c6aeff7e3:1
value 28666
address 1FhFGwMGnx1y7cvjxDY4tD3ZDypB2jMqSD
value 65020
address 34AtRAbn6Du1dhRoG9HHqGCQwWfC1hJH1a